Optimization of Fe2+ Removal from Coal Mine Wastewater using Activated Biochar of Colocasia esculenta
The present study investigates the sorptive removal of Fe2+ from simulated coal mine waste water using steam activated biochar (SABC) developed from the roots of Colocasia esculenta.
